Ronald William Thompsen, 86, of Donovan

Ronald William Thompsen, 86, of Donovan passed away on Tuesday, September 24, 2024 at Riverside Medical Center in Kankakee. He was born on August 16, 1938 in Crescent City (Crescent Twp.), a son of Reinhart and Lydia (Lehmann) Thompsen and they preceded him in death in addition to two brothers, Donald and Francis Thompsen; and one sister, Delores Judy.

 

Ronald married Betty Avery on December 27, 1964 in Baudette, MN and she survives. Also surviving are one son, David (Jennifer) Thompsen of Clifton; one daughter, Cheryl (Tom) Vargo of Homewood; six grandchildren, Hannah (Michael) St. Aubin, Benjamin Thompsen, Katherine Thompsen, Joseph Thompsen, Nora Vargo and Lydia Vargo; one brother, Gordon (Linda) Thompsen of Martinton; and several nieces and nephews.

 

Mr. Thompsen served in the U.S. Air Force and was a member of the Cissna Park American Legion and Calvary Lutheran Church in Watseka. He was a pilot, owned Thompsen Aviation, flew a jet for Roper’s, and was a repairman for IBM for 30 years. Ronald enjoyed restoring old international tractors and was a member of the Central Green Club.

 

Visitation will be from 4:00-7:00 pm on Friday, September 27, 2024 at the Knapp Funeral Home in Watseka and also 1 hour prior to the service at the church on Saturday.

 

Funeral services will be at 11:00 am on Saturday, September 28, 2024 at Calvary Lutheran Church in Watseka with Rev. Aaron Uphoff officiating. Burial will follow at St. John’s Lutheran Cemetery at Schwer with graveside military rites by the Cissna Park American Legion.

 

Memorials may be made to Calvary Lutheran Church in Watseka or Uplifted Care Hospice.
